Haiti - Politic : ONI announced an identification program at birth

Monday, as part of the weekly press conference of the Ministry of Communication, Jean-Baptiste St-Cyr, Director of the National Identification Office, revealed that 3 million National Identification Cards (CIN) were produced in 2015. "Because of the elections, the validity of the cards had been delayed for a better participation," explaining that the new biometric system (fingerprint) allows a much better security in the citizen identification process. He said that this ultra sophisticated and reliable system, which cost US $ 50 million to the Haitian government, had nothing to envy to our neighbors in the region.

In addition, he recalled that every adult citizen, not being in possession of their identity card, is liable to a fine of 500 gourdes, stating that in case of loss or theft, the citizen must make a declaration to the police for his safety, adding that the ONI receives no fee for replacing a CIN lost, stolen or damaged. However, recall that in 2017, the law on the renewal and the the pay reprinting of national identification cards will come into force.

He also informed that the United Nations under the Program of Identification and Documentation of Haitian Immigrants (PIDIH), had issued more than 30,000 identification cards (valid for 10 years) to undocumented Haitians in the Dominican Republic and 2,000 other cards will be distributed shortly.

Finally, he announced that in order to provide reliable identification, tamper-proof to everyone, a identification at birth program was launched by the ONI. In this context, the midwives will be very involved in the data collection.
